Review: Rome's Maledetta Discoteca Records present their latest pride and joy, an impeccable emulation by the Neapolitan Funkool Orchestra of the indelible sigla (aka single) style of Italo disco popular throughout the 1970s. With the creation of an anthem in mind, the idea for 'Maledetta Discoteca' (taking its namesake from the label) and 'Tiene 'O Tiempo' was born after the musicians found time and space to scour their own 7" vinyl vaults, noticing for the first time that many of the singles they'd collected over time were in fact theme songs from TV and radio shows. With lead vocals from Valentina Conte, the A-side's lyrics deal thematically with the legendary disco club La Discoteca, while the B is just as insouciant and effortless, adding more spice and horn section to the brew.

Review: First released way back in 1982 but exceedingly hard to find ever since, Intrigue's 'I Like It' is a classic slab of Brit-funk era UK boogie whose lyrics playfully muse on craving cash when you have very little ("I really want your love but I'd rather have the money and I like it"). This Backactcha Records reissue features both versions from the original 12" - the EP-leading full vocal mix and the longer, more club-focused flip-side instrumental - as well as what appears to be a previously unreleased remix. This builds up brilliantly via drums and short rap sections before introducing the killer basslibe, pianos, synths and lead vocals. It's a fantastic and arguably more club-ready take on a much-loved but previously impossible-to-find Brit-boogie classic.

Review: Timmy Thomas' Why Can't We Live Together is a timeless soul classic that got some remix treatment in 1981. Originally released in 1972, the track's message of unity and love is still relevant today, and Liebrand's remixes gave it a modern disco edge that appealed to new listeners fans of dance music. The story, according to Ben Liebrand himself, goes: "This is a mashup/bootleg mix of Timmy Thomas and T-Connection's At Midnight made by yours truly. The Belgian record company 'took' this mix, had this Mike sing on top of it and released it as their own. When people started to realize the 'origins' of this mix, the company re-recorded everything, fed the new versions amongst the illegal versions, and thus conveniently obscured the amount of 'bootleg-versions' sold." Review: Originally recorded in the late 1970s and using many of the musicians employed by Diana Ross on her track 'The Boss'. 'Can't Put No Price On Love' has long been regarded as North End's 'long lost' single - an inspired disco workout employing that pre-dates the Arthur Baker/Tony Carbone-helmed project's most famous song, Tee Scott/Larry Levan favourite 'Happy Days'. The original multitrack was unfortunately lost, but the track finally appears, 40-odd years after it was recorded. Whether what we're hearing was finished and mixed at the time is uncertain, but the 'Club Mix' is certainly authentic sounding - a genuinely energetic, joyous and effervescent New York disco number with full orchestration, addictive vocals (Jocelyn Brown & Dennis Collins on backing Vox) and a killer groove. Elsewhere across the EP, we get two versions of 'We Can't Live Like This Anymore' - the synth-laden, solo-heavy disco-boogie style original mix (B2) and a superb 'drum break' percussion tool (A2) - and a brilliantly low-slung instrumental dub-disco cover of The Temptations' 'Cloud 9'.

Review: Pleasure of Love reissue imprint, New Islands, launches with a quiet stormy, soulful Balearic stunner. Kim Yaffa's 'Once Bitten' was recorded in LA and released on a 1989 private press 7", only to be buried in American record bins for decades after. A re-emergence of Yaffa's music on the internet in the last couple years has reached a fever pitch, with collectors thirsting after copies of the record. Now, New Islands has worked directly with the artist to deliver an official reissue, professionally transferred from the mixdown reels, carefully restored, and remastered. The track is an effortless class-act pop tune, with 80s blue eyed soul / Sade inspired sounds, and unknowingly Balearic production that renders it timeless (it's reminiscent of Linda Di Franco, Edie Brickell or 80s Fleetwood Mac). The 12" is rounded out by new mixes from Michael David (Classixx) and Nick the Record & Dan Tyler (Record Mission).
